Hamilton Parish Wins Dudley Eve Final
Hamilton Parish claimed a 2-1 victory over the Paget Lions in the Dudley Eve Trophy final at Wellington Oval on Sunday. Jordan Outerbridge gave Hamilton Parish the lead in the 19th minute, but Paget Lions equalized four minutes later through Diaje Hart. North Village Claim Leonard DeRosa U15 Title
The North Village Rams secured the Under-15 Leonard DeRosa Holder Cup championship with a decisive 4-1 victory over the PHC Zebras. Amir Brangman-Johnson opened the scoring for the Rams in the 11th minute, followed by a goal from Jason Dixon DeSilva four minutes later.
